    Title Corsa Exhaust Diverters
    Description I ordered my diverters directly from Corsa back in 1998. They had my model on file and sent me everything in one kit. The kit required me to raise the exhaust elbows by 3 inches by inserting a 3 inch spacer...this was based upon their engineering data for the hull/model...there can be variations in where an engine sits in relation to the waterline depending upon the hull when the boat is not on plane. This is necessary to minimize any possibility of water backflowing into the manifolds from the thru-hull exhaust tips. There are butterfly valves in the exhaust tips which protect against any surges from wave/swells hitting the back of the boat. Overall, installation was pretty simple...a little scarey when it came to cutting the holes through the transom...I measured at least 12 times first. Since installing them, I have had no problem what-so-ever with them. I utilized a spare switch on the panel to the starboard side of the steering wheel. The only problem I ever had was accidently leaving the switch on and draining the battery. The big question....did I see any increase in speed? No...but honestly...you think anyone spends the money putting them on a stock boat/engine for performance???? Hey, give me a break....I was single back when I put them in!!!
